I sent a Letter of Intent already but am considering a update letter to send in January before decisions come out. Is this okay or should I wait to see decisions first before sending another update?
 
I sent a Letter of Intent already but am considering a update letter to send in January before decisions come out. Is this okay or should I wait to see decisions first before sending another update?
I spoke with someone at the MN campus and they said that a letter of intent won't change the initial ranking that you were given after the interview. She said all letters of intent and updates etc. will begin to have influence once they start picking from the waitlists after initial decisions have been made.

They explicitly say they do not want pre-interview updates. I don't know about letters of interest, but I guess it would follow the same rule.

I spoke with someone at the MN campus and they said that a letter of intent won't change the initial ranking that you were given after the interview. She said all letters of intent and updates etc. will begin to have influence once they start picking from the waitlists after initial decisions have been made.

Now, instructions on letters of interest/updates on interview day are in some conflict with the website and my communication with the admissions office. On interview day, I wrote down that active communication with the admissions office is encouraged and "helps your chances." I don't know if it was in specific reference to waitlist movement, but it sounded like general advice for the remainder of the cycle. Moreover, the staff mentioned updating them as a means of keeping in touch, rather than only providing "significant experiential updates" per their website.

A lot has changed since then, so I don't really know what to think anymore.
